The Battle of Hohenlinden was fought on 3 December 1800 during the French Revolutionary Wars.A French army under Jean Victor Marie Moreau won a decisive victory over an Austrian and Bavarian force led by Archduke John of Austria.The allies were forced into a disastrous retreat that compelled them to request an armistice, effectively ending the War of the Second Coalition. Three days in Tuscany gives you a couple of options as far as lodging: you can either stay in Florence the whole time and take day trips out, you can stay in a smaller city the whole time and simply take a day trip to Florence, or you can split it uptwo nights in one city, and one in another. That being saidthere are a million ways to get off the beaten path in Rome no matter when you visit, and while touristic hotspots like the Colosseum and Spanish Steps are nearly always crowded, fascinating places like the Capuchin Crypt, the Palazzo Doria Pamphilj, the Basilica of St. Paul Outside the Walls, plus the neighborhoods of Testaccio, Ostiense, and Monti in general, are just a few of the many great places to enjoy Rome without dense crowds. Since long before the First World War, the Italian Regia Marina ' s First Squadron had been based at Taranto, a port-city on Italy's south-east coast.In the inter-war period, the British Royal Navy developed plans to counter the Italian navy in the event of a war in the Mediterranean.
